Time Analyst

The Time Analyst is an AI-Powered agent that analyzes the reported time for the worker and compares it with previous time cards to provide analysis and insights. This can provide suggestions for submission or approval of a time card based on the persona of the user accessing it. 

It compares the current time card with prior time cards to provide a summary of the entries, identifying any perceived deviations for the user to review and correct before submission or approval. 

Built on Oracle’s AI Agent framework and powered by large language models (LLMs), the advisor understands natural language queries and responds with accurate, secure information based on user's data access and role privileges. 

Time Analyst Can

  • Review the current and previous 3 time cards reported hours and provide insights and analysis.
  • Answer questions or recommend actions for users based on the analysis.
  • Context aware - Both workers and managers can use this agent, with the responses / analysis fine tuned to the specific user persona. When a worker interacts with the agent, the agent provides responses that are appropriate for a worker to assist in his / her review prior to submission. When managers interact with the agent, the same agent provides analysis and recommendations that helps with their approval decisions.

Examples of Employee Questions the Agent Can Answer:

  • “Analyze my time card”
  • “Analyze the overtime hours and compare with the past time cards.”
  • “Can I submit this time card ?"
  • “Can I approve this time card ?"

Steps to enable and configure

Your environment must have the appropriate services for Oracle Applications Platform deployed. For more information, see FAQ2521 on My Oracle Cloud Support.

  1. Set the Enable Security Console External Application Integration (ORA_ASE_SAS_INTEGRATION_ENABLED) profile option to Yes and enable permission groups for the appropriate roles. See Access Requirements for AI Agent Studio.
  2. Deploy the AI agent team using the delivered template.
  3. Create a guided journey with the AI agent as a task.  
  4. Add the AI agent to Redwood timecard using the guided journey from step 2.

     Cohort A customers can receive the SAS roles via CWB 20260501 for runnable agents. Others will receive this as part of their regular 26B upgrade.
